Latest Patents

Gang Liu's latest patents include an ultrasonic imaging method, an ultrasonic imaging system, and a non-transitory computer-readable medium. The ultrasonic imaging method involves generating multiple anatomical plane schematics and displaying them. Each schematic corresponds to a different anatomical plane of interest. The method also includes acquiring an ultrasonic image of the anatomical plane and automatically generating a thumbnail of the image. This thumbnail replaces the corresponding anatomical plane schematic on the display. Additionally, he has developed methods and systems for shear wave elastography. These innovations allow for targeted ultrasound imaging of regions of interest, enhancing the efficiency and effectiveness of medical diagnostics.
